At home, a professionally installed Level 2 charger is the cornerstone of easy PHEV ownership. Plug in after dinner and the lithium-ion battery can reach 100% overnight, so you wake up ready for your commute, school drop-offs, and errands — often using electric power alone. Because the Outlander Plug-in Hybrid intelligently blends EV Drive, Series Hybrid, and Parallel Hybrid modes, it automatically chooses the best way to move based on load, speed, and battery state. On a typical weekday, that means quiet, emissions-free EV driving for local miles, supported by regenerative braking that helps recapture energy when you slow down. When your plans stretch beyond your usual routine, the gas engine extends range smoothly, so your schedule stays on track.

Public charging adds flexibility. Around town, Level 2 stations are useful for top-ups while you shop or dine. For road trips, DC Fast Charging is the time-saver: at a compatible station, a quick session can bring the battery to approximately 80% in about 38 minutes, giving you enough charge to continue comfortably. In winter, smart planning matters just a bit more. Preconditioning — warming the cabin and battery while plugged in — helps preserve electric range and makes the vehicle cozy before you unplug. Twin Motor S-AWC (Super All-Wheel Control) and seven available drive modes, including Snow and Gravel, help you maintain surefooted traction when the weather turns. On those colder days, using seat heaters and heated mirrors can reduce reliance on cabin heat, further supporting electric efficiency. Frequently Asked Questions:

Do I need a special outlet to charge at home?

A dedicated 240V circuit with a Level 2 EVSE is recommended. It enables overnight charging to 100% so you start each day ready to drive electric. A licensed electrician can advise on circuit capacity and installation details in your home.

How does DC Fast Charging help on trips?

DC Fast Charging shortens stop time significantly by charging the battery to approximately 80% in about 38 minutes at a compatible station. Plan breaks near these stations and you can refuel your Outlander Plug-in Hybrid and yourself at the same time.

What if I cannot install a Level 2 charger at home?

You can still combine public Level 2 charging with 120V/240V charging options and the vehicle’s hybrid capability. Many owners charge at work or near regular shopping destinations to keep electric miles high and fuel use low.

Will cold weather reduce electric range?

Like all EVs and PHEVs, cold temperatures can affect range. Preconditioning while plugged in, using seat heaters, and selecting appropriate drive modes help mitigate the impact. Twin Motor S-AWC and Snow mode support confidence when conditions deteriorate.
